org.apache.jackrabbit.core.query
Class QueryManagerImpl
java.lang.Object
org.apache.jackrabbit.core.query.QueryManagerImpl
- All Implemented Interfaces:
- QueryManager
public class QueryManagerImpl
- extends Object
- implements QueryManager
This class implements the QueryManager interface.
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
QueryManagerImpl
public QueryManagerImpl(SessionImpl session,
ItemManager itemMgr,
SearchManager searchMgr)
- Creates a new
QueryManagerImpl for the passed
session
- Parameters:
session - itemMgr - searchMgr -
createQuery
public Query createQuery(String statement,
String language)
throws InvalidQueryException,
RepositoryException
-
- Specified by:
createQuery in interface QueryManager
- Throws:
InvalidQueryException
RepositoryException
getQuery
public Query getQuery(Node node)
throws InvalidQueryException,
RepositoryException
-
- Specified by:
getQuery in interface QueryManager
- Throws:
InvalidQueryException
RepositoryException
getSupportedQueryLanguages
public String[] getSupportedQueryLanguages()
throws RepositoryException
-
- Specified by:
getSupportedQueryLanguages in interface QueryManager
- Throws:
RepositoryException
Copyright © 2004-2007 The Apache Software Foundation. All Rights Reserved.